U.S. Senator Ben Sasse released the following statement Monday announcing that Steve Nelson, former president of the Nebraska Farm Bureau (NEFB), has joined his staff as a senior agriculture policy advisor.
"It's Nebraska's job to feed the world -- and we're darn good at it. We're leading the way, but we have to keep pushing for more trade deals and less Washington red tape. Steve is an expert, and I'm proud to have him on our team as we keep working hard to serve Nebraskans."
Nelson farms near Axtell and served as NEFB president for nine years beginning in 2011.
